<p>Hidden in the strange land south of Home Depot in <span style="text-decoration: line-through;">Ashburn </span>Broadlands is a gem of a restaurant simply called<em> <a href="http://www.americanflatbread.com/restaurants/ashburn-va/" target="_blank">American Flatbread.</a></em></p>
<p style="text-align: center;">“Food is important.</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">What we eat and how it is grown<br />
intimately affects us and<br />
the well-being of the world.”</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><small>George Schenk<br />
American Flatbread Founder</small></p>
<p style="text-align: left;">So, while American Flatbread is neither a woman nor a woman-owned business, two LoCo women decided to go there anyway, in order to grasp at the sanity that the third week of summer vacation had ground up into a puree of sunscreen and playground mulch.</p>
<p>American Flatbread serves locally-grown, organic flatbread topped with everything from ham and apples to kalamata olives and goat cheese. Plus, they also have a dazzling selection of beer and wine to keep you on your alcohol-loving toes. I was shocked to discover they do not serve Heineken, but delighted when I was recommended a PILS beer, because it was pretty darn close to my beloved Heineken.</p>
